Angelina Jolie, Chris Barrie, Ciaran Hinds. Lara Croft returns this time to find the ancient Pandora's Box, a mysterious relic with unknown powers, before a diabolical genius uses it as a doomsday weapon. 2003/color/117 min/PG-13.Amazon.com
Lara Croft: Tomb Raider, The Cradle of Life is certainly better than its 2001 predecessor, but its appeal is mostly aimed at fans of the video games that inspired both movies. That pretty much leaves you with some fun but familiar action sequences, and the ever-alluring sight of Angelina Jolie (reprising her title role) as she swims, swings, kicks, shoots, flies, jet-skis, motorcycles, and free-falls her way toward saving the world, this time by making sure that a grimacing villain (CiarĂ¡n Hinds) doesn't open Pandora's Box (yes, the actual mythological object) and unleash a deadly plague that will "weed out" the global population. Exotic locations add to Jolie's own coolly erotic appeal, but we're left wondering if this franchise has anywhere else to go. --Jeff ShannonSimilarProduct
